Important Dates for Candidates
The UPSSSC PET 2026 exam dates have been officially announced, providing candidates with vital information for their preparation. It is crucial for applicants to stay updated on these important dates to ensure they do not miss any essential deadlines.
- Application Start Date: The registration process for the UPSSSC PET 2026 will commence on January 15, 2026.
- Application End Date: Candidates must submit their applications by February 14, 2026.
- Admit Card Release: The admit cards will be made available for download on March 25, 2026.
- Exam Date: The UPSSSC PET 2026 will be conducted on April 15, 2026.
- Result Announcement: Results are expected to be declared by May 5, 2026.
Candidates are advised to prepare thoroughly and adhere to the timelines to ensure a smooth examination process. Keeping track of the UPSSSC PET 2026 exam dates is essential for success.
Shift Timings Explained
The UPSSSC PET 2026 exam will be conducted in multiple shifts to accommodate a large number of candidates. Understanding the shift timings is essential for those preparing for the exam, as it ensures that candidates arrive at the right time and are well-prepared for their respective sessions.
The exam is scheduled to take place over several days, with each day divided into different shifts. Here are the key shift timings:
- Morning Shift: 9:00 AM to 11:00 AM
- Afternoon Shift: 2:00 PM to 4:00 PM
Candidates are advised to report to their designated exam centers at least 30 minutes prior to the start of their shift. This allows sufficient time for verification of documents and ensures a smooth entry into the examination hall.

How to Download Admit Card
The admit card for the UPSSSC PET 2026 exam is a crucial document that candidates must download and carry to the examination center. Here’s a step-by-step guide on how to obtain your admit card.
To download the admit card for the UPSSSC PET 2026 exam, follow these simple steps:
- Visit the Official Website: Go to the official UPSSSC website where notifications and updates are regularly posted.
- Navigate to the Admit Card Section: Look for the link related to the “UPSSSC PET 2026 Admit Card” on the homepage.
- Enter Required Details: Fill in the necessary information such as your registration number, date of birth, and any other details as prompted.
- Download the Admit Card: Once your details are submitted, you will be able to view and download your admit card.
- Print and Verify: After downloading, make sure to print the admit card and verify all the details for accuracy.
It is essential to keep the admit card safe, as it will be required on the day of the examination.
